Is the fraction 1/3 equivalent to a terminating decimal or a decimal that does not terminate
umka21 [38]
<span>1/3 is equivalent to a decimal that does not terminate. A terminating decimal is one that ends. Some decimals never end, however. If you divide 1 by 3 using the standard algorithm, you will get 0.333333... repeating forever. This is a non-terminating decimal, or repeating decimal. In contrast, 1/4 is equal to 0.25, which is a terminal decimal.</span>

Find the measure of /_ MFZ
marshall27 [118]

Given:

MZ\cong PZ

m\angle MFZ=(x+9)^\circ

m\angle PFZ=(2x-1)^\circ

To find:

The measure of angle MFZ.

Solution:

In triangles MFZ and PFZ,

m\angle FMZ\cong \angle FPZ           (Right angle)

MZ\cong PZ           (Given)

FZ\cong FZ           (Common side)

\Delta MFZ\cong \Delta PFZ                  (HL congruent postulate)

\angle MFZ\cong \angle PFZ           (CPCTC)

m\angle MFZ=m\angle PFZ

x+9=2x-1

9+1=2x-x

10=x

The value of x is 10.

The measure of angle MFZ is:

m\angle MFZ=(x+9)^\circ

m\angle MFZ=(10+9)^\circ

m\angle MFZ=19^\circ

Therefore, the measure of angle MFZ is 19 degrees.
